Championship Showdown: Critical Survival Battles and Promotion Races Heat Up

This week's EFL preview focuses on the nail-biting Championship survival scrum and the intense promotion races, highlighting crucial matchups that could define the season.

The Championship Survival Struggle

As the Championship season approaches its climax, the battle to avoid relegation intensifies. With only 10 games left, several teams are in a desperate fight to stay above the dotted line. This midweek round could be pivotal with six relegation-threatened teams directly facing off.

Cardiff City vs. Luton Town In what is essentially a six-pointer, Cardiff City hosts Luton Town. Luton, sitting five points from safety, needs a win to close the gap, whereas Cardiff aims to extend their cushion from the relegation zone. Historical form suggests Cardiff might have the edge, especially with Luton’s dismal away record this season.

Derby County vs. Coventry City Derby County, fresh off ending a 12-game winless streak, now faces the mammoth task of taking on Coventry City, the Championship’s form team. Despite Coventry’s formidable run, Derby’s strong home form could make this an intriguing contest.

Plymouth Argyle’s Relegation Threat

Plymouth Argyle’s situation becomes increasingly dire with each passing week. Having not won away all season, their trip to Portsmouth, who have only lost once in their past 12 home games, looks ominous.

Hull City vs. Oxford United

Hull City’s recent form has seen them climb out of the relegation zone. They host an Oxford United side that’s also flirting with the drop, making this another crucial encounter for both teams.

The Race for Promotion

The battle for automatic promotion remains fiercely contested. Leeds United, Sheffield United, and Burnley are all within touching distance of the top spot, each with key fixtures this week that could significantly impact their promotion hopes.
